Transaction 21ad0748678bfd3883e63958273de4765d98153aa99b7d125eef0d52bb1254ee
1 Input
2 Outputs
- 21ad0748678bfd3883e63958273de4765d98153aa99b7d125eef0d52bb1254ee:0
- 21ad0748678bfd3883e63958273de4765d98153aa99b7d125eef0d52bb1254ee:1
value 7566159
address 16mADrq9E1RkAwsHcEvLQD7T67hqwQPQJy
value 10969922
address 1amDsd3xkdSyAiH7TooUwHRwJRULnEuoJ